PROGRAM DESCRIPTION

This program is a creative format of the MA in Business Administration which proposes new, intense relations between the world of business and the world of design.

In design driven firms, managers must be able to combine managerial skills, creativity and entrepreneurial spirit, within a perspective able to embrace at the same time design and production, tradition and innovation, reality and vision, everyday life and future. The modern manager is a figure that gets trained and thrives in a border area where designers, managers and entrepreneurs, experts in enterprise and corporate organizations, in information technology, communication, marketing, contribute to the creation of new operative codes and a new strategic language for the companies and the market.

The Master Course in Business Design stems from the core idea that the project is the hinge and the guide of the enterprise and it aims at bringing quality within the territories of product, services and social enterprises. In accordance with this view, the Master Course in Business design is an interdisciplinary faculty founded on an innovative teaching model that applies a radical vision of the learning by doing approach to realize an environment in which students learn by doing, analyzing problems, designing and verifying the solutions, interfacing at the same time with a network of entrepreneurs and companies who participate actively and directly in the students’ training.

PROGRAM STRUCTURE
  • The first part of the course is mainly didactic and is articulated in lectures and seminars, that is workshops where the students work in team on a brief given by partner companies and by the MBD team.
  • The focus consists of a moment of work and research that each student carries out in a company or consulting or design studio, broadening one of the themes faced during the first part of the course.
  • The course is concluded with a final project, the thesis (September – October) that the students have to develop under the guidance of MBD staff and a mentor chosen among the members of the Faculty or among the visiting professors of the course.

Lectures are held from Monday to Friday, from 9:30am – 1:30pm & 2:30pm – 5:30pm.

AUDIENCE

This program is geared towards new graduates and young professionals coming from economic, human science and design-related faculties who wish to learn how to combine creativity, managerial skills and entrepreneurial spirit through a multidisciplinary approach.
